I've nuked pth and everything that depends on it on my
i386/1.6_BETAsomething machine, and did a "make install" in
pkgsrc/audio/gqmpeg. It did rebuild everyting from source.

When starting gqmpeg, I get a core dump.
The same happens when using binary pkgs from latest i386 bulk builds, and
also for other pkgs that use pth (mozilla, galeon, ...).

Am I the only one seeing that?
